The branches have long been used as dowsing rods or divining rods to find underground water sources.

Witch hazel plants. Plants stretch to heights of 20 to 30 feet tall with a spread of 15 to 20 feet. It tends to fill out right to the ground and therefore doesnt necessarily require facer plants in front and is suitable for planting under power lines. Hamamelis vernalis Ozark witch hazel is a 6- to 10-foot shrub hardy in zones 4 to 8.

The most commonly used variety is Hamamelis virginiana. Common Witchhazel will grow to be about 18 feet tall at maturity with a spread of 20 feet. Without pruning plants will grow 15-30 feet tall with a similar width.

Native shrubs are most often found in wooded areas along the east coast of North America from Canada to Georgia. Outside of North America there is one species native to China and another species native to Japan. Growing witch hazel shrubs is a favorite amongst gardeners looking for winter color and fragrance.

It has yellow blooms with red centers that appear in winter to early spring. The Witch Hazel plants bright yellow blossoms come only after the leaves have fallen during late fall to early winter. It is composed of four main species.

Forming large shrubs or small trees they come into their own in late winter and early spring when scented flame-coloured ribbon-like flowers appear on bare branches. The hazel family Hamamelidaceae is comprised of over 100 species of trees and shrubs including winter hazels ironwoods sweetgums and the witch hazels.

Wild witch hazel is a native plant in Maine with a centuries-old track record of medical uses so well proven that its one of the few botanicals approved by the federal government. The plant sets out pretty yellow flowers that are fragrant and resemble dainty ribbons in the fall. That grows into a large shrub or a small tree.

Witch hazel shrubs can reach 30 feet 9 m high and 15 feet 45 m wide at maturity and are often referred to as a tree due to this. Hamamelis virginiana common witch hazel is a 15- to 20-foot-tall shrub that flowers with yellow blooms from October to December. Witch hazel is a native Maine plant that can treat a variety of health conditions.

Witch hazel is a large shrub or a small multi-stemmed tree that is native to North America China and Japan. For plants purchased in pots or containers you can plant in other seasons than fall as long as both hot and cold spells are avoided. Witch hazel is native to both North America and Asia.

The common witch hazel tree produces fragrant yellow or burgundy firework-shaped flowers for two to four weeks starting in November which is also when the foliage begins to shift in shade. Witch hazels Hamamelis are popular plants for the winter garden. There are also varieties native to Japan and China.

From this family the Garden exhibits not only species types but also hybrids. Witch hazel is a native plant in the US. It grows at a medium rate and under ideal conditions can be expected to live for 50 years or more.

It is hardy in zones 3 to 8. Although a great choice plant for the northern facing gardens or woodland landscapes Witch Hazel have other purposes. In total there are hundreds of winter-flowering witch hazel Hamamelis spp shrubs throughout the grounds.

Virginiana grows in the eastern part of the United States and blooms in late fall. 11 rows In the wild you can see witch hazel growing as an understory plant beneath larger trees. The planting of witch-hazel is preferably performed in fall to promote root development before winter.
